The story grabs you from the offset: a thunderstorm causing a delayed flight.

Then a chance meeting of an old college acquaintance, Jeff, leads to the luxury of a first class lounge for the wait and a catch up on the life of someone he didn’t even know that well.

We start to learn of Jeff’s life since leaving college and about the pivotal event that has shaped his life since.

The telling feels very nostalgic, almost wistful of what could have been. It also sounds like a confessional. Why would Jeff start divulging his life story in this way to someone that he was barely acquainted with at college?

There’s more to learn about the author as well. We don’t know his name. We only know he hasn’t drunk in years and he’s on his way to see a publisher in Germany.

I’m very intrigued as to how this continues as there’s a mystery to unravel, about both Jeff and the author.
